On Sun, Jul 14, 2002 at 10:05:09AM +0200, Vojtech Pavlik wrote:
>
> Unfortunately this doesn't list interrupts, which happened, but are no
> longer claimed by any driver - and the i8042 driver frees the interrupt
> when it detects no device.

        Interesting.. it detects it, as per dmesg below, but then it frees
it.. really interesting..

> > From the above part of .config, IRQ1 should be set for the keyboard,
> > while IRQ 12 for the AUX port. 12 is set, 1 is not. dmesg shows:
> >
> > mice: PS/2 mouse device common for all mice
> > serio: i8042 KBD port at 0x60,0x64 irq 1
> > input: ImPS/2 Microsoft IntelliMouse on isa0060/serio1
> > serio: i8042 AUX port at 0x60,0x64 irq 12
>
> So it detected both the KBD and AUX ports properly, but for some reason
> it couldn't identify the attached keyboard.
>
> Can you #define ATKBD_DEBUG in drivers/input/keyboard/atkbd.c?
> Then you'll see what happened in' dmesg'.

        Just did. dmesg follows:

> Most likely you have a somewhat unusual keyboard - it may be responding
> too slow perhaps, so that the driver times out - or doesn't support some
> of the commands the driver expects to use.
>
> Or the mouse kills the keyboard. This also can happen - they share
> common resources. This would need more debugging then.
>
> So, what's the keyboard, what's the mouse, and what's the mainboard
> exactly?

        I've tried this with 3 different keyboards, 3 different mice, and 3
combinations of each: wireless 104-key ps/2 keyboard. PS/2 cord from the box
to the keyboard base, actual keyboard is wireless. bought it 4 years ago;
104-key keybord (w/power, sleep, and wake keys) bought 3 weeks ago, 104-key
acer keyboard from a P100 from 7 years ago. all 3 mice are PS/2 mice; Acer
mouse to go along with the Acer box and Acer keyboard, Microsoft PS/2 mouse,
and MS Optical wheel mouse. The Acer and MS PS/2 mouse are straight PS/2. The
optical is IMPS/2. motherboard is a Tyan S2390B, VIA82c686b chipset.

        All 9 different combinations gave the same result. Mouse working,
keyboard not working.
